1.    Tracking Fixed Assets

Tracking a large number of fixed assets can be exhausting, especially if you are starting a business where such fixed assets need different maintenance conditions or need to be attached to different locations.

With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central, you can easily track them by setting up a card with specific information for each fixed asset. Here you can specify what kind of asset it is, set up buildings or production equipment like a main asset with several components to be grouped in different ways. You can identify them by grouping them by class, department, location, and more. For each fixed asset, you must set up a card containing information about the asset. You can set up buildings or production equipment as the main asset with a component list, and you can group them in various ways, such as class, department, or location:

In the identification card of the fixed asset, you can also state budgeted assets and anticipate new acquisitions and sales.

2.    Tracking depreciation

In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central, you can create depreciation books for each fixed asset within your company. This is performed by running an automatic report to calculate periodic depreciation; then it is filled in the journal ready to be posted.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central can calculate depreciation in various ways, and set many depreciation books for each fixed asset for taxation, internal reporting, and any other operation you may need. 3.    Record Maintenance costs

Maintenance and insurance costs can be easily tracked with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central. For every asset, the maintenance costs and service dates can be recorded and managed. The solution facilitates the management of expenses in accordance with your budget and additionally helps you to identify when a fixed asset must be replaced. The assets can be linked to one or more insurance policies. This helps you verify policy amounts are accurate while monitoring annual insurance premiums:
